表单域元素是网站和应用程序中不可或缺的部分,它们用于收集用户输入的数据。一个设计良好的表单可以显著提升用户体验,而一个设计不佳的表单则可能导致用户流失。本文将深入探讨表单域元素的设计原则,并提供实用的技巧来提升用户体验。
一、了解表单域元素
1.1 表单域元素概述
表单域元素主要包括输入框、单选框、复选框、下拉菜单、文本域等。这些元素共同构成了一个表单,用于收集用户的各种信息。
1.2 表单域元素的作用
- 收集用户信息:如姓名、邮箱、电话等。
- 提供交互方式:用户可以通过表单与网站或应用程序进行交互。
- 数据验证:确保用户输入的数据符合要求。
二、提升用户体验的原则
2.1 简化流程
- 减少步骤:尽量减少表单的步骤,避免用户在填写过程中感到繁琐。
- 必填项标记:清晰标注必填项,避免用户遗漏重要信息。
2.2 清晰的指引
- 明确标题:表单标题应简洁明了,让用户一眼就能了解表单的目的。
- 辅助文字:提供必要的辅助文字,如输入框下的提示信息。
2.3 有效的反馈
- 实时验证:对用户输入进行实时验证,及时给出反馈。
- 错误提示:当用户输入错误时,给出清晰的错误提示。
三、具体实践技巧
3.1 输入框
- 类型选择:根据需求选择合适的输入框类型,如文本框、数字框等。
- 长度限制:合理设置输入框的长度限制,避免用户输入过多或过少。
3.2 单选框和复选框
- 明确选项:选项应清晰易懂,避免歧义。
- 排列方式:合理排列选项,提高可读性。
3.3 下拉菜单
- 选项数量:根据实际情况,合理设置下拉菜单的选项数量。
- 搜索功能:提供搜索功能,方便用户快速找到所需选项。
3.4 文本域
- 高度限制:合理设置文本域的高度限制,避免用户输入过多。
四、案例分析
以下是一个表单设计案例,展示了如何运用上述原则和技巧:
<form>
<h2>注册账号</h2>
<label for="username">用户名:</label>
<input type="text" id="username" name="username" required>
<br>
<label for="email">邮箱:</label>
<input type="email" id="email" name="email" required>
<br>
<label for="password">密码:</label>
<input type="password" id="password" name="password" required>
<br>
<label>性别:</label>
<input type="radio" id="male" name="gender" value="male" required>
<label for="male">男</label>
<input type="radio" id="female" name="gender" value="female" required>
<label for="female">女</label>
<br>
<label for="country">国家:</label>
<select id="country" name="country">
<option value="china">中国</option>
<option value="usa">美国</option>
<!-- 其他国家选项 -->
</select>
<br>
<button type="submit">注册</button>
</form>
五、总结
通过以上分析,我们可以看出,合理设计表单域元素对于提升用户体验至关重要。掌握相关原则和技巧,结合实际案例,可以帮助我们打造出既美观又实用的表单,从而提高用户满意度。
